This February, LifeMoves celebrated the launch of its newest interim supportive housing community, LifeMoves Branham Lane—a transformative project designed to provide safe, stable housing for individuals and couples experiencing or at risk of homelessness.

Located in South San Jose, LifeMoves Branham Lane is the second-largest modular development in Project Homekey’s history. The 204-unit, three-story site replaces a former grass lot that had become a gathering space for encampments. Now, it offers housing, supportive services, and a path to lasting stability for up to 216 clients at a time.

LifeMoves Branham Lane is designed with the voices of those  who have experienced homelessness in mind. Its vibrant colors  and integrated artwork make the space feel welcoming, while  thoughtful design elements encourage community, well-being, and progress.

Beyond providing interim housing, LifeMoves  Branham Lane offers a holistic suite of services, including  personalized case management, housing and employment assistance, and healthcare support. The goal is to empower clients to overcome barriers and navigate their journey toward long-term stability.

LifeMoves Branham Lane reflects our commitment to forward-thinking solutions. The interim housing community incorporates solar panels to reduce energy costs and environmental impact, while a community garden grows fresh vegetables for nutritious meals and offers a peaceful space for clients to reconnect with nature. Additionally, safety and sustainability are at the forefront of the design. Features like permeable asphalt pavement and grated walkways manage rainwater efficiently, reducing runoff, preventing puddles, and keeping pathways clear year-round.

With the launch of LifeMoves Branham Lane, LifeMoves is pursuing bold possibilities— expanding interim housing solutions that are scalable, sustainable, and centered on the dignity and success of our unhoused neighbors.
